How to fill out Direct Account Debit Authorization for Automatic Quarterly Tax and Water and/or Sewer Payments

01
Obtain the Direct Account Debit Authorization form from your local tax authority or water/sewer department.
02
Fill in your personal information, including your name, address, and contact details.
03
Provide your bank account information, including the account number and routing number.
04
Specify the payment amount (if applicable) and the frequency of the debit (quarterly).
05
Sign and date the authorization form to confirm your consent.
06
Submit the completed form to the designated department (tax authority or water/sewer department).
07
Retain a copy of the authorized form for your records.

The IRS can take money out of your bank account when you have an unpaid tax bill, but levies aren't automatic. If you owe unpaid tax debts to the federal government, the IRS has to follow the proper procedures to take money from your bank account.
The debit by the IRS includes the employer and employee taxes for Federal Income Tax, Medicare, and Social Security. These taxes are debited directly by the IRS and will labeled as USATAXPYMT on your bank statement.
The Electronic Federal Tax Payment System is a free service that gives taxpayers a safe and convenient way to pay individual and business taxes online or by phone using the EFTPS® Voice Response System.
Simply put, an IRS Direct Debit Installment Agreement (DDIA) is when you make payments to the IRS directly from your bank account. You can set up a direct debit payment method with multiple Installment Agreements, and in some cases, the IRS may require you to set up automatic payments.
"IRS USA Tax Payment," "IRS USA Tax Pymt" or something similar will be shown on your bank statement as proof of payment. If the payment date requested is a weekend or bank holiday, the payment will be withdrawn on the next business day.

Direct Account Debit Authorization for Automatic Quarterly Tax and Water and/or Sewer Payments is a financial agreement that allows the local government or utility company to automatically withdraw funds from a taxpayer's bank account on a quarterly basis to pay for property taxes and water or sewer services.
Property owners and utility customers who wish to set up automatic payments for their quarterly tax, water, and/or sewer bills are required to file the Direct Account Debit Authorization.
To fill out the Direct Account Debit Authorization form, individuals need to provide their bank account details, including account number and routing number, along with personal information such as their name, address, and the specific tax or utility account details.
The purpose is to simplify the payment process for taxpayers and customers by ensuring timely payments, reducing late fees, and minimizing manual transactions.
The information required includes the taxpayer's or customer's name, address, bank account number, bank routing number, the type of payments being authorized, and their signature to confirm consent.
